"Your browser is not supported" warning on top

Added by Tad Delude over 10 years ago

Hello,

I noticed the “Your browser is not supported” bar at the top displays on browsers which are running a modern layout engine such as Gecko. I use Waterfox (which is a 64bit verison of Firefox) and the message displays.

I would like to see either the option to disable this warning, a way for the user to close the warning which is pervasive, or a mechanism to detect the browsers layout engine instead of the browser type. (Such as is the browser a new version of Gecko, Blink, and so on.)

The “Your browser is not supported” notification is always displayed when another than the officially supported browsers is being used.

Feel free however to open a feature request to change this behavior in the Wish List.
